Pros

* Fair pay, fair benefits * Job security is a bonus * Well known (looks good on resumes)

Cons

Toxic culture and a damaged employment brand. Rigid, top-down chain of command. You have no discretionary authority to make a decision, yet you're held 100% accountable. Very low morale (especially in ACC - claims call centers). The Workforce Management software controls EVERY movement you make, even down to bathroom breaks. Overwhelming workload and lack of manpower. Bosses who monitor stats all day and chastise you for going 10 seconds too long on a call (shouldn't we be helping and satisfying the customer?).
